前言
在当今互联网环境下,许多用户都需要寻找可靠的翻墙工具来突破网络封锁,访问被屏蔽的网站和服务。两种常见的翻墙工具 v2ray 和 ss(shadowsocks) 都受到广泛关注和使用。那么,这两种工具究竟有什么区别?哪一个更适合您的需求呢?
本文将从多个角度对 v2ray 和 ss 进行全面的对比和分析,帮助您更好地了解两者的特点和适用场景,为您选择最合适的翻墙工具提供依据。
1. 协议差异
v2ray 和 ss 的最大区别在于所使用的网络协议不同。
- ss 使用的是 Shadowsocks 协议,这是一种基于 SOCKS5 代理的加密传输协议,可以有效隐藏用户的真实 IP 地址。
- v2ray 则支持多种协议,包括 VMess、VLess、TROJAN 等,这些协议在安全性和隐藏性方面都有所提升。
总的来说,v2ray 的协议选择更加丰富和灵活,能够更好地适应不同的网络环境和用户需求。
2. 功能特性
v2ray 和 ss 在功能特性方面也存在一些差异:
- v2ray 支持更多的传输方式,如 TCP、mKCP、WebSocket 等,可以更好地绕过网络审查和限制。同时还提供了 DNS 伪装、分流等高级功能。
- ss 相对来说功能较为简单,但是配置和使用更加简单易上手。
对于追求更强大功能的用户来说,v2ray 无疑是更好的选择。但如果您只是想要一个简单实用的翻墙工具,ss 也是不错的选择。
3. 性能表现
在性能方面,两者也有一些区别:
- v2ray 由于支持更多的传输方式和协议,在网络环境较差的情况下表现更加出色,延迟和丢包率相对较低。
- ss 相对来说性能较为稳定,但在恶劣的网络条件下可能会出现较高的延迟和丢包。
因此,如果您需要在较差的网络环境下进行翻墙,v2ray 可能是更好的选择。但如果您的网络环境较为良好,ss 也完全可以满足您的需求。
4. 安全性
在安全性方面,v2ray 相比于 ss 也有一定优势:
- v2ray 支持更多的加密算法和传输方式,可以更好地抵御网络监测和审查。
- v2ray 还提供了 TLS 加密等高级安全功能,能够更好地保护用户的隐私和安全。
但是,只要选择正确的加密算法和服务器,ss 也能够提供较高的安全性。关键在于用户的使用习惯和配置方式。
5. 部署和维护
在部署和维护方面,两者也存在一些差异:
- v2ray 的部署和配置相对更加复杂,需要一定的技术基础。但它提供了更加灵活的部署方式,如 Docker 等。
- ss 相对来说部署和配置更加简单,适合技术水平较低的用户。但在维护和升级方面可能需要更多的精力。
对于追求更高定制性的用户来说,v2ray 可能是更好的选择。而对于追求简单易用的用户,ss 可能更加合适。
6. 使用场景
综合以上各方面的比较,我们可以总结出 v2ray 和 ss 的适用场景:
- v2ray 更适合于需要更高安全性、更强大功能的用户,或者在网络环境较差的情况下使用。
- ss 更适合于追求简单易用的用户,或者网络环境较为良好的情况下使用。
当然,具体使用哪种工具还需要根据个人的实际需求和网络环境来选择。
7. 总结
通过以上的比较和分析,相信您已经对 v2ray 和 ss 有了更加全面的了解。无论您选择哪种工具,希望它都能够满足您的翻墙需求,让您顺利访问被屏蔽的网站和服务。
FAQ
1. v2ray 和 ss 哪个更安全?
v2ray 在安全性方面有一定优势,支持更多的加密算法和传输方式,能够更好地抵御网络监测和审查。但只要选择正确的加密算法和服务器,ss 也能够提供较高的安全性。
2. v2ray 和 ss 哪个速度更快?
在网络环境较差的情况下,v2ray 由于支持更多的传输方式和协议,表现更加出色,延迟和丢包率相对较低。而ss相对来说性能较为稳定,但在恶劣的网络条件下可能会出现较高的延迟和丢包。
3. v2ray 和 ss 哪个更容易使用?
ss 相对来说部署和配置更加简单,适合技术水平较低的用户。而v2ray的部署和配置相对更加复杂,需要一定的技术基础。
4. v2ray 和 ss 哪个更适合翻墙?
两者都是常用的翻墙工具,适用于不同的使用场景。v2ray更适合于需要更高安全性、更强大功能的用户,或者在网络环境较差的情况下使用。ss更适合于追求简单易用的用户,或者网络环境较为良好的情况下使用。
5. v2ray 和 ss 哪个更耗资源?
一般来说,v2ray由于支持更多的传输方式和协议,在资源消耗方面略高于ss。但具体的资源消耗情况还需要根据具体的使用环境和配置来判断。